Writing in his Sunday World column, Doyle explained: "Shane Long is one of one of our most dangerous players, but he didn’t get much opportunity to have a big enough influence on the game – I know from experience that playing up front on your own for Ireland is no easy task.
"I felt it was a time to bring on Daryl Murphy with Shane to take some of that load. Yes we would have lost a midfielder, but we bypass that area of the field a lot of the time anyway."Shane spent most of his energy chasing down a lot of high balls and that is not making best use of his talents, but we didn’t have enough of the ball to take control of the game and that affected our attacking intent.!"
Doyle recognises O'Neill's tendency to encourage his players to bring a fearless attitude to games but believes that the lack of concrete instructions can sometimes hinder the team's chances.
"We have a manager who gives the players freedom to express themselves and work out a game for themselves in many ways," Doyle continued.
"O’Neill does not send his players onto the field with a load of instructions and messages and, while having a clear mind is helpful in some ways, it doesn’t always work.
"It’s a method that has brought him success in the past and we have to hang on to the hope that we have a big performance in our locker in the Italy game."
